Emirates To Upgrade Interiors of 120 Aircraft As Airline Expands Fleet

Emirates recently announced that it is undertaking its largest fleet retrofit project ever, involving 67 Airbus A380s and 53 Boeing 777s. This project is part of a multibillion-dollar investment that Emirates is making as a part of the “Fly Better” campaign that began in November 2018. A Look at Frenchbee’s Premium Economy Class

Part of Paris-based Frenchbee’s low-cost strategy is to eliminate business class. The company has instead opted for a two-class cabin with 376 economy seats and 35 premium seats.
